Women’s Soccer Records Third-Straight ACC Victory by Shutting Out Pitt
10/17/2025 9:31:00 PM | Women's Soccer
PITTSBURGH, Pa. – Mana Nakata provided the game-winning score to propel NC State women's soccer (5-6-4, 4-1-2 ACC) to its sixth-straight unbeaten ACC contest and third-straight league win in a 1-0 victory at Pittsburgh (5-8-2, 1-6-0 ACC) on Friday night at Ambrose Urbanic Field. With the win, NC State secured its most league victories since 2021 and most overall wins since 2022.
The first half was quiet offensively with no goals between the teams as the Panthers outshot the Pack, 4-2. Olivia Pratapas made both of her first half saves early in the frame to help NC State go into the break tied with Pitt at zero.
The second half was a different story for the Wolfpack, who came out aggressive after halftime. Nakata provided the breakthrough in the 61st minute, collecting a rebound off a blocked shot by Jade Bordeleau and slotting it into the goal to give NC State the lead. The Pack matched Pitt in second-half shots, 5-5, and controlled the flow of play to close out the victory.
In the whole match, NC State held a 60-40 edge in possession and earned four corner kicks while not allowing any from the Panthers.
On defense, the Wolfpack recorded its second-consecutive shutout and fifth clean sheet of the season. Pratapas finished the night with four saves, while the back line of Yuna Aoki, Alex Mohr, Brooklyn Holt, and Mackenzie Smith cleared out Panther threats all night to preserve the win.
Of Note:
- With Friday's victory, NC State's ACC unbeaten streak extends to six games, tied for its longest stretch since 2017.
- Tonight's win gives the Pack its first three-game conference win streak since the 2021 season.
- The Pack now has four ACC wins this season, tied for its most since 2021 when it also recorded four conference victories.
- NC State now has five wins on the year, its most in a season since 2022.
- Tonight's win puts NC State ahead of Pitt in the lifetime series, 6-5. It is also the first win for the Wolfpack over Pittsburgh since 2018.
- With the victory over Pitt, NC State is a perfect 3-0-0 in the month of October.
- Nakata's goal was her second of the season and fourth of her career as she has now matched her freshman year total in points with seven.
- Pratapas recorded a pair of back-to-back shutouts for the second time this season, finishing the night with four saves. She now has five clean sheets on the year.
